# Web2MCP

**Turn any website into a standalone MCP server.**

**AI Agent Auto-Install:** Point your agent to this repo and say "install web2mcp" — it will read this README, detect your MCP client (Kilo/Claude Desktop), and configure itself automatically.

## Features

- **Discovery** - Analyze websites: JSON-LD, API endpoints, HTML forms, headings, links
- **OpenAPI Detection** - Auto-detect and parse OpenAPI/Swagger specs
- **Code Generation** - Generate complete MCP server projects from any website
- **Credential Management** - Encrypted storage for API keys, tokens, cookies, OAuth
- **Multi-Protocol** - Works with any HTTP API (REST, GraphQL, etc.)

## Available Tools

| Tool | Description |
|------|-------------|
| `web2mcp_discover` | Analyze a website |
| `web2mcp_request` | Make HTTP requests with auto-injected auth |
| `web2mcp_auth_store` | Manage credentials (save/load/list/delete) |
| `web2mcp_auth_oauth` | OAuth 2.0 flow helper |
| `web2mcp_api_spec` | Parse OpenAPI/Swagger specs |
| `web2mcp_schema` | Infer JSON schema from endpoints |
| `web2mcp_sitemap` | Parse sitemap.xml |
| `web2mcp_forms` | Extract HTML forms |
| `web2mcp_readme` | Fetch GitHub READMEs |
| `web2mcp_generate` | **Generate a standalone MCP server** |

## How It Works

1. **Discover** - Web2MCP analyzes the target website
2. **Detect** - Looks for OpenAPI specs at standard locations (`/openapi.json`, `/swagger.json`, etc.)
3. **Generate** - Creates a complete MCP server project with typed tools per endpoint
4. **Use** - Install, build, and run the generated MCP server

## Generated MCP Servers

The generated MCP servers:
- Are standalone Python projects
- Share web2mcp's credential store (auth set up once works everywhere)
- Auto-inject credentials for every request
- Include typed tools for each API endpoint (if OpenAPI spec found)
- Fall back to generic HTTP tools if no spec available
